[2] The brothers possessed complementary skills for establishment of a sports blog, with Adam having a background in sportswriting and Zach in web design.
[2] Zach Best explained in a 2015 interview that the company moniker was derived from what the brothers felt was the one-sided nature of sports team fans.
[3] In an October 2015 interview, Adam Best explained the formula for his company's rapid growth: Over time, the site expanded to include other professional sports, as well as more topics, including general news, entertainment, lifestyle and fandoms like Game of Thrones, The Walking Dead, and Star Wars.
[2] The FanSided network, including its mobile app and newsletter, was acquired by Time Inc., publisher of Sports Illustrated, on May 26, 2015.
[6] Under terms of the acquisition, founders Adam and Zach Best were to continue to oversee FanSided as a division of Sports Illustrated Group.
